How to Install BlueStacks for Windows 10 64-Bit Offline Installer

BlueStacks is an Android emulator that allows you to run Android apps and games on your Windows PC. It’s a great way to enjoy your favorite mobile apps on a larger screen, with more powerful hardware. In this blog post, we’ll show you how to install BlueStacks for Windows 10 64-bit offline installer.

How to Install BlueStacks for Windows 10 64-Bit Offline Installer: Step-by-Step Guide

Step 1: Download the BlueStacks Offline Installer

The first step is to download the BlueStacks offline installer. You can do this by visiting the BlueStacks website and clicking on the "Download" button. Make sure to select the "Offline Installer" option.

Step 2: Run the BlueStacks Offline Installer

Once the download is complete, run the BlueStacks offline installer. You will be prompted to select a language and installation directory. Once you have made your selections, click on the "Install" button.

Step 3: Follow the On-Screen Instructions

The BlueStacks offline installer will now guide you through the rest of the installation process. Simply follow the on-screen instructions and click on the "Next" button when prompted.

Step 4: Complete the Installation

Once the installation is complete, click on the "Finish" button. BlueStacks will now launch automatically.

Step 5: Enjoy Your Android Apps and Games

You can now start using BlueStacks to run your favorite Android apps and games. To do this, simply click on the "My Apps" tab and search for the app you want to install.

How to Install BlueStacks for Windows 10 64-Bit Offline Installer: Troubleshooting

If you encounter any problems while installing BlueStacks, you can try the following troubleshooting tips:

  • Make sure that your computer meets the minimum system requirements for BlueStacks.
  • Disable any antivirus or firewall software that may be blocking the installation.
  • Try running the BlueStacks offline installer as an administrator.
  • If you are still having problems, you can contact BlueStacks support for assistance.
